    <title>2019 (7) TMI 786 - NATIONAL COMPANY LAW TRIBUNAL, HYDERABAD BENCH, HYDERABAD</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=383090</link>
    <description>The Tribunal admitted the Petition for Corporate Insolvency Resolution under Section 10 of the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code, 2016. A moratorium was declared, prohibiting suits or proceedings against the Corporate Debtor, ensuring essential supplies, and appointing an Interim Resolution Professional. The process commenced due to default in loan repayment, with the total outstanding debt amounting to &amp;amp;8377;8,02,32,677 owed to various financial creditors. The Tribunal&#039;s decision aimed to facilitate the resolution process and address the financial challenges faced by the Corporate Applicant, setting the stage for further proceedings in line with the IBC, 2016.</description>
